Output bf7c8d77c617cc77d2eead27717e2b0a52c31d8acb66c8a777a6c35d82839642:0

value
1098331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b3495d782d7d772e2ea374eac76f333ed704af OP_EQUAL
address
3MuG2zHH6nzaK28AGcyyBfQi5iiKwXxEmR
transaction
bf7c8d77c617cc77d2eead27717e2b0a52c31d8acb66c8a777a6c35d82839642
spent
true